## Authentication

Bramblefog supports hot-reloading of plugin configuration without restarting the host. Plugin authors push config updates to the reload endpoint; changes apply within five seconds. Reload requests are authenticated — unauthenticated pushes are dropped silently to prevent probing. Tokens are scoped per plugin and cannot reload other plugins' config. Watch the `reload.ack` event to confirm application. For local development against the Wrenmoor sandbox, authenticate each reload request with the sandbox credential shown below.

session JWT of yawep-yawep = eyJhbGciOiJIUzI1NiIsInR5cCI6IkpXVCJ9.eyJzdWIiOiI3pWF3_In0.aXYsHiog

Subject: Key rotation — GreenPulse scheduler API

Plugin authors,

We're rotating credentials for the GreenPulse watering scheduler effective Friday. Old keys stop working at cutover; no grace period this time. If your plugin calls the schedule, moisture, or zone endpoints, swap keys before then. Rate limits and endpoints are unchanged. Staging already runs on the new credential set, so test there first. Questions go to the plugin channel. The new key for the internal scheduler service follows below.

API key for tawep-fawip: zpat15_Ngeaqpk5w7LhWo5

Retention enforcement now drops whole partitions instead of running bulk deletes, which removes the long-lived delete grants the old job required. The sweeper role loses DELETE and keeps only DDL on the partition parent. Access paths for the reporting reader are unchanged; row-level policies carry over to each child partition automatically. Rollout is gated behind the `ledger_partitioning` flag. The partition maintenance job uses the following tuning constants.

tuning table, kajog-bawip:
TIERS = {
    "kelius": 256,
    "lammir": 543,
}

Ticket: Missed pick-up — locked case of test units

Heads up for the Dunmere receiving site: the Quillon Logistics driver never showed yesterday for the locked case of Sparrowhawk prototype test devices, so it's still sitting in our cage. We've rebooked for tomorrow between 9 and 11. Case stays locked end to end — nobody at your end needs to open it, just log it in as sealed. When the driver turns up, give them the hand-over instruction below.

drop instructions, yafog-yawip: the quenmir olidor courier leaves the julox tamion keliel ledger at gate 5283 under passcode 336825